At the Grand Islander Center, the cost for a private room is set at $7,950 per month, which notably exceeds both the Newport County average of $5,275 and the broader Rhode Island average of $5,211. This difference reflects not only the premium services and amenities offered at Grand Islander but also its commitment to providing an enriching living experience tailored to individual needs. While it may come at a higher price point compared to local and state benchmarks, many families find value in the specialized care and supportive atmosphere that the Grand Islander Center provides.

Staff communication and support stand out
Families repeatedly describe staff as attentive and communicative.
Many reviewers say the team keeps families informed and responds with helpful guidance, especially during changes in condition or discharge planning. Several mention nurses, CNAs, therapists, and other departments working together so they feel confident their loved one is being looked after. A few comments also point to difficulties reaching administrative staff by phone, which creates frustration for some families even when care teams are viewed positively.

Clean, well-kept facility comes up
Residents and visitors often describe the building as clean and well kept.
A recurring theme is that the facility looks clean and inviting, including bright, cheerful spaces that make visits easier. Some reviewers specifically contrast good cleanliness with concerns about odors, dirty rooms, or rundown conditions described in other visits. Taken together, cleanliness is a clear point of focus in feedback, with experiences varying by unit and timing.

Therapy support is a big draw
Rehabilitation and therapy help residents make progress.
Several reviewers describe strong therapy experiences, including physical therapy and speech or occupational therapy as part of recovery. Families often attribute improvements to dedicated therapists and care teams that keep loved ones motivated. A smaller number of accounts raise concerns about missed or limited therapy and ineffective follow-through during discharge, which affects how consistently residents received the support they needed.

Staffing and responsiveness raise concerns
Some families report breakdowns in responsiveness and staffing.
Alongside praise, a recurring concern is responsiveness—missed call-button requests, delays with assistance, and trouble getting timely communication from certain parts of the facility. Several reviewers also mention being left unattended in hallways or rooms, as well as issues tied to care continuity like medication problems or equipment support. A few accounts describe serious physical-safety concerns such as bed sores, injuries, or infections, while others frame the problem as a need for more caregivers on each shift.

Dementia, including Alzheimer’s disease, is often mischaracterized in terms of lethality as it leads to complications that can be fatal rather than being a direct cause of death; it causes a progressive decline in cognitive and physical health, making patients vulnerable to infections and other health crises. Effective management of nutrition, hydration, and communication is crucial in patient care, with palliative care becoming vital in advanced stages to enhance comfort and quality of life while caregivers play a key role amidst the challenges posed by the disease.
Reminiscence therapy helps individuals with dementia recall past memories through structured discussions and meaningful objects, enhancing mood, relationships, and sense of identity while celebrating their lives. It can be practiced in formal settings or at home, requiring sensitivity to personal histories and cultural backgrounds.
Reminiscence therapy is a structured method for older adults, especially those with dementia, to share life stories using prompts and sensory cues, fostering emotional well-being, social engagement, and self-identity. It aims to improve quality of life by enhancing interpersonal connections and cognitive stimulation while requiring careful facilitation to avoid distressing memories.
